Irving is the son of Wm. Albert "Bert" and Priscilla Jane (Eskridge)Roberts. He was born in Knoxville, Knox, Tennessee. He married Mary Elizabeth Doolin in Illinois, then as a newly wed served in the Spanish American War. Irving was a "railroad man" moving West as the railroad progressed toward the West and Salt Lake City, serving as a conductor. After retirement, he along with Mary became a rancher in Declo, then Rupert, Idaho. Together they had 3 sons and 2 daughters.
